Home » US Law » 2022 Maryland Statutes » Health Occupations » Title 2 - Audiologists, Hearing Aid Dispensers, Speech-Language Pathologists, and Music Therapists » Subtitle 4 - Prohibited Acts; Penalties » Section 2-402.4 – Representation to Public Only by Persons Authorized as Audiology Assistants — Words or Terms Limited to Authorized Audiology Assistants

    (a)    Unless authorized to practice as an audiology assistant under this title or unless otherwise provided for under this article, a person may not represent to the public, by title, description of services, methods, or procedures, or otherwise, that the person:

        (1)    Is authorized to practice as an audiology assistant in the State; or

        (2)    Assists in the practice of audiology.

    (b)    Unless authorized to practice as an audiology assistant under this title or unless otherwise provided for under this article, a person may not use any word or term connoting professional proficiency in assisting the practice of audiology, including:

        (1)    “Audiology assistant”;

        (2)    “Audiologist assistant”;

        (3)    “Audiometry assistant”;

        (4)    “Audiometrist assistant”;

        (5)    “Audiological assistant”;

        (6)    “Hearing aid technician”; or

        (7)    “Cochlear implant technician”.
